What account managers earn in Cleveland
Hourly first — that's how the offer arrives
| Experience | Hourly | Annual, full-time |
|---|---|---|
| Entry level | $22–$29 | $46k–$60k |
| Mid level | $30–$41 | $63k–$85k |
| Senior | $42–$58 | $87k–$120k |
Adjusted for the Cleveland market from national ranges.

Interview questions worth rehearsing
With the thing the interviewer is actually listening for
Tell me about an account you saved from churning.
Show early detection of risk signals, a candid conversation about the gap, and a concrete recovery plan with the result.
How do you grow revenue within an existing account?
Describe mapping the org for new stakeholders, tying expansion to the client's goals, and timing asks around delivered value.
A client is unhappy about something your company got wrong. How do you handle it?
Acknowledge plainly, avoid defensiveness, fix what you can quickly, and follow up in writing. Trust is built in these moments.
How do you run a quarterly business review that clients actually value?
Focus on their outcomes and next-quarter plans, not a product usage dump. Bring one insight they did not already know.
How do you manage a large book of accounts without dropping any?
Talk about tiering accounts, scheduled touchpoints, health scores or risk flags, and disciplined CRM notes.
Tell me about balancing what the client wants with what your company can deliver.
Give an example of setting honest expectations and negotiating a workable middle rather than overpromising.
Resume tips that move the needle
For account managers specifically — generic advice costs you here
Lead with retention and growth numbers, such as net revenue retention or renewal rates on your book.
State the size and shape of your book: number of accounts, total ARR or revenue, and client types.
Include one save story and one expansion story as concrete bullets with results.
Show cross-functional work, like coordinating support or product fixes for clients, since that is daily reality.
Name your tools, including the CRM and any customer success platforms you have used.
